  • Page 6 Step 7 Adjust pressure control to desired setting. The tdple jet nozzle must be positioned to one of the two settings for high pressure cleaning by turning the nozzle tip. The pencil jet spray CO _) should be used for stubborn dirt. The High pressure fiat spray (25_) should be used for cleaning over a large surface area.
